S. Thangapazham Agricultural College, situated in Tenkasi, Tamil Nadu, is widely recognized as a significant constituent college of the prestigious Tamil Nadu Agricultural University (TNAU), Coimbatore. Established in 2017, the institution has swiftly built a reputation for its dedicated pursuit of excellence in agricultural education and research. It plays a crucial role in shaping skilled professionals for the evolving agricultural landscape of India.

The college''s primary academic offering is the comprehensive B.Sc. (Hons.) Agriculture program, which is designed to provide students with a deep understanding of agricultural sciences, modern farming techniques, and sustainable practices. The curriculum integrates both theoretical knowledge and extensive practical training, preparing students for real-world challenges. Admissions to this highly sought-after program are based on merit from 12th standard board examinations, followed by the rigorous counseling process conducted by TNAU, ensuring that only dedicated and meritorious students are enrolled in the 120 available seats.

STAC boasts a modern campus environment equipped with essential facilities to support advanced agricultural studies. Students benefit from well-maintained laboratories, experimental fields, and a supportive learning atmosphere that encourages innovation and hands-on experience. The institution focuses on holistic development, fostering not only academic prowess but also practical skills vital for agricultural careers. Graduates from S. Thangapazham Agricultural College are well-prepared for diverse opportunities in agricultural research, agribusiness, farm management, extension services, and government sectors, contributing significantly to food security and rural development. The college''s affiliation with TNAU further enhances its academic standing and opens avenues for advanced learning and career progression within the agricultural domain.
